Ticket BRK-1182: Circuit breaker for the Orchardpipe upstream API

Plugin authors calling Orchardpipe through the Hollybridge SDK will soon go through a shared circuit breaker. When the breaker opens, calls return a retryable error instead of timing out. Plugins must handle this error code before the rollout. Sign-off on the rollout date is required from the person named below.

account owner for bawip-tahag: Raleth Quenok

Soft deletes in Cartwheel's orders table deserve care. We never hard-delete rows; instead, deleted_at is stamped and the row is excluded by the default query scope in OrderRepo. Background jobs must opt into including tombstoned rows explicitly, otherwise reconciliation against the ledger drifts. If you add an index, remember to make it partial on deleted_at IS NULL, or the planner regresses badly. Before shipping any migration touching this table, sign the artifact with the team's release key, shown here for reference.

deploy key for kajof-fajop: bky6_gDHw9Q

- [ ] Collect the sealed-bid envelope for the Harrowfield Depot tender from the locked cabinet in Room 4 before 08:30. Verify the wax seal is intact, the envelope is unmarked except for the tender reference, and it is double-bagged. Record the collection time in the off-site log. The courier from Bramleigh Express must follow the hand-over instruction below exactly.

courier memo of fajeg-yagag: the pramir keleth courier leaves the wenax holox ralix ledger at gate 8171 under passcode 428648

Lost badges at the Kelvaro Works site must be reported to the gatehouse immediately. Do not attempt to tailgate or borrow another contractor's pass; both are grounds for removal from site. The gatehouse will deactivate the lost badge within fifteen minutes and issue a paper day-pass valid until shift end. Replacement badges are printed next business day and collected in person with photo identification. A fee may apply for repeat losses. Until your replacement arrives, use the temporary door code below.

door code, yagap-bahof: bdg-O-05